Arrêt du produit de base et des serveurs secondaires

Lorsque vous arrêtez le produit de base RICOH ProcessDirector ou un serveur secondaire distant, vous pouvez arrêter le système après ou avant la fin de la procédure de traitement du travail. Si vous avez installé la fonction de support AFP, vous pouvez également choisir d'arrêter les processus initiés par le pilote d'impression RICOH ProcessDirector, par Download for z/OS ou encore par AFP Download Plus.

Après un arrêt ou un redémarrage du système, toutes les imprimantes sont désactivées. Si vous souhaitez que toutes les imprimantes activées avant l'arrêt soient activées après le redémarrage du système, vous pouvez modifier la valeur de la propriété système Mémoriser le statut activé des imprimantes sur Oui.

Pour arrêter le produit de base ou un serveur secondaire distant :

  1. Connectez-vous au système en tant qu'utilisateur du système RICOH ProcessDirector ( aiw1 est la valeur par défaut).
  2. Accédez à la ligne de commande.
  3. En option: Pour minimiser l'impact de l'arrêt du système sur les processus en cours d'exécution, désactivez les unités d'entrée associées au serveur.
  4. Saisissez l'une des commandes suivantes :
    • Pour arrêter immédiatement le système sans attendre la fin de la procédure :
      • stopaiw

      Toute étape en cours de traitement sera déplacée en état d'erreur lors du redémarrage du système.

    • Pour arrêter le système après la fin de la procédure de traitement en cours :
      • stopaiw -q
    • Pour arrêter le système et tous les processus qui ont été lancés par le composant pilote d'impression, par Download for z/OS, ou par AFP Download Plus :
      • stopaiw -t

      Cette option est uniquement disponible un ordinateur principal sur lequel la fonction de support AFP a été installée.

    Sur l'ordinateur principal, la commande arrête le serveur principal, les serveurs secondaires locaux, le programme d'interface utilisateur et le centre de documentation. Si un serveur secondaire distant est connecté au serveur principal lors de l'arrêt de ce dernier, le serveur secondaire tente de rétablir la connexion toutes les 30 secondes, jusqu'à ce qu'il puisse se connecter ou jusqu'à ce que le serveur secondaire distant s'arrête.

    Sur un ordinateur secondaire, la commande déconnecte le serveur secondaire distant du serveur principal et arrête le serveur secondaire.

  5. En option: Bien que la commande stopaiw arrête RICOH ProcessDirector, il est parfois nécessaire de suivre certaines étapes supplémentaires pour s'assurer que tous les traitements sont terminés. Il s'agit notamment des situations suivantes :
    • Application des mises à jour du système d'exploitation.
    • Reprise du système de fichiers contenant /aiw. Vous pouvez, par exemple, déplacer le système de fichiers vers une nouvelle unité de stockage.
    • Exécution d'une sauvegarde complète du stockage. Par exemple, tout arrêter afin que les transferts de données n'aient pas lieu lors de la sauvegarde.
    Pour interrompre tous les autres traitements liés à RICOH ProcessDirector :
    1. Si vous utilisez une configuration PostgreSQL, exécutez la commande systemctl stop postgresql
    2. Les étapes suivantes requièrent l'autorité racine. Saisissez su - root appuyez sur Entrée. Lorsque vous y êtes invité, saisissez le mot de passe de l'utilisateur root (superutilisateur) et appuyez sur Entrée.
    3. Si vous utilisez une configuration DB2, saisissez /opt/infoprint/ippd/db/bin/db2fmcu -d
    4. Si vous utilisez une configuration DB2, saisissez ps -ef | grep db2 pour afficher tous les processus db2 en cours d'exécution. Pour arrêter chaque processus db2, saisissez :
      kill suivi de chaque identifiant de processus listé dans les résultats de la commande grep. Vos résultats, par exemple, ressembleront peut-être à ce qui suit :
      dasusr1  14729     1  0 Aug24 ?   00:00:01 /home/dasusr1/das/
                                                  adm/db2dasrrm
      root     18266     1  0 Aug24 ?   00:15:08 /opt/infoprint/ippd/db/
                                                  bin/db2fmcd
      dasusr1  18342     1  0 Aug24 ?   00:00:23 /opt/infoprint/ippd/db/das/
                                                  bin/db2fmd -i dasusr1 -m /
                                                  opt/infoprint/ippd/db/das/
                                                  lib/libdb2dasgcf.so.1
      root     21049     1  0 Sep01 ?   00:00:00 db2wdog 0 [aiwinst] 
      aiwinst  21051 21049  0 Sep01 ?   01:13:01 db2sysc 0  
      root     21059 21049  0 Sep01 ?   00:00:00 db2ckpwd 0 
      aiwinst  21061 21049  0 Sep01 ?   00:00:00 db2vend (PD Vendor 
                                                 Process - 1) 0    

      Dans ces résultats, les identifiants de processus sont listés dans la seconde colonne. Pour mettre fin au premier processus de la liste, saisissez kill 14729 et appuyez sur Entrée.

    5. Saisissez ps -ef | grep psfapid pour afficher tous les processus psfapid. Pour arrêter chaque processus psfapid, saisissez :
      kill suivi de chaque identifiant de processus listé dans les résultats de la commande grep.
    6. Saisissez ps -ef | grep aiw1 pour afficher tous les processus aiw1. Pour arrêter chaque processus aiw1, saisissez :
      kill suivi de chaque identifiant de processus listé dans les résultats de la commande grep.